History
Gates and gatepiers built by Sir Clough Williams-Ellis, architect and owner of the Brondanw estate from 1908 until his death in 1978. Conceived as vista gates at the end of a long straight path from Plas Brondanw to the foot of the hill upon which the folly Brondanw Tower stands.  

Exterior
Tall, square rubble piers with moulded rubble capping and reconstituted stone urn finials. Plain wrought iron gates with decorative overthrow surmounted by a polychromed decorative crown. Short, low flanking sections of wall curve outwards (away from the tower).
